Episode 630…during this 50th anniversary of Michael Landon’s adaptation of Little House On The Prairie actor/producer Dean Butler shares with us Prairie Man Dean Butler shares the behind- the-scenes of Little House on the Prairie on a heartfelt journey of "good luck, good television, and the very good- if gloriously imperfect-people who made it so." Cast as Almanzo, Laura Ingalls' starring love interest, Butler captured the enduring affection of fans and co-stars alike. With a foreword from Melissa Gilbert (Laura) and Alison Arngrim (Nellie), this uplifting memoir follows Butler's journey from childhood to the Prairie and beyond. Cast at twenty-two years old, Butler had no idea of the lasting impact being cast in Little House on the Prairie would have on him. Having previously starred in Judy Blume's Forever with Stephanie Zimbalist, Butler was fresh- faced and naïve to Hollywood, eager to make his mark. He found his home in the Prairie and embraced his fellow cast members as family. Butler's passion for honest-to-goodness entertainment began in the Prairie and followed him throughout his rich career of acting, producing, and directing.

Her book is Undefeated Changing the Rules and Winning on My Own Terms Shaunie Henderson (1.8 million followers on Instagram) left her marriage to Shaquille O'Neal with nothing more than her five young kids and her car and became a trailblazing media mogul, philanthropist, and creator of the hit TV franchise Basketball Wives. In her debut book, UNDEFEATED: Changing the Rules and Winning on My Own Terms, Shaunie Henderson-wife, mother, entrepreneur, producer -- opens up about finding love, offers advice for raising strong, smart, grounded Black children in today's world, and reveals how to define your career and personal life by your own terms in this inspirational memoir.

The non-profit https://www.healthiergeneration.org/ is expanding its work to give all young people a chance a t lifelong good health and the opportunities that come with it.
Healthier Generation has partnered with https://www.healthiergeneration.org/campaigns/kohls-healthy-at-home to provide a wealth of tools in English and Spanish to help families eat healthy, stay active, bolster mental/social/emotional health, combat stress and more. A $5 million donation from Kohl’s Healthy at Home to Healthier Generation is helping to expand the new, Healthy at Home Playbook for Schools, which provides schools with the necessary resources to be named one of America’s Healthiest Schools. (Nearly 3,000 schools have been honored with this recognition.)

Middle Of The Rainbow Emmy Award winning actress, Bonnie Bartlett Daniels is still at it in front of the camera at 94 years old. The actively working actor (Little House on the Prairie, Golden Girls, Home Improvement, Twins, ER, Parks and Recreation and Better Call Saul, to name a few) has finally opened up with her life story and the not-so-pretty experiences she endured during the "Golden Age" of film and TV for her memoir Middle of the Rainbow. Now, Bonnie Bartlett Daniels herself narrates the Audible audiobook of Middle of the Rainbow, giving listeners a chance to hear her personal narrative in her own voice.

With fans clamoring for the full track after she shared a raw demo on her social platforms, Sarah Reeves officially releases “More Than Enough” on Friday, May 3rd. The pop artist penned the self-affirming original following heightened insecurities amidst a painful divorce. The song’s viral success, however, stems from its universal message and Reeves’ uncanny ability to craft transparent lyrics that hit deep. The vibrant, 808-heavy anthem renounces the lies that tell us we’re not worthy of love and insists our value is not dependent on our relationship status or the opinions of others.

The struggle to Play It Forward Episode 623 with U.S. Ambassador Ira Shapiro the author of The Betrayal How Mitch McConnell and the Senate Republicans Abandoned America. The Founding Fathers gave the U.S. Senate many functions, but it had one fundamental responsibility—its raison d’etre: to provide the check against a dangerous president who threatened our democracy. Two hundred and thirty years later, when Donald Trump, a potential authoritarian, finally reached the White House, the Senate should have served as both America’s first and last lines of defense. Instead, we had the nightmare scenario: today’s Senate, reduced through a long period of decline to a hyper-partisan, gridlocked shadow of its former self, was unable to meet its fundamental responsibility. Shapiro documents the pivotal challenges facing the Senate during the Trump administration, arguing that the body’s failure to provide leadership represents the most catastrophic failure of government in American history. The last section of the book covers the Senate’s performance during President Biden’s first year in office and looks forward to the 2022 Senate elections and beyond.

Alyssa is a self-proclaimed cat lady. When Alyssa is not performing on stage, you can usually find her at home with her fiancé, five cats and puppy. Alyssa loves to write songs and sometimes serenade her animals with her music. Having grown up around singers, Alyssa's mother had a deep connection to music and started her own karaoke business when Alyssa was just a kid. Alyssa enjoyed karaoke throughout most of her life, and when she was in her early 20s decided to start a band. Putting out an ad on Craigslist for more band members was just the start of her current band, WildCard. All the other band members are men in their 50s, but she enjoys holding her own as the only woman on the stage
